WebNov 18, 2024 · Random sampling examples include: simple, systematic, stratified, and cluster sampling. Non-random sampling methods are liable to bias, and common examples include: convenience, purposive, snowballing, and quota sampling. In convenience sampling, the collection of data from the subjects is dependent on their ease of access. In other words, the entities that are easily accessible to the researcher form the sample.
